Choose all of the correct answers. 5. (5 pt) Which are accurate descriptions of the book The Prince and its ideas and influence? Choose all answers that are correct. A. A ruler should exercise power virtuously for the common good of his people. B. European rulers rejected the book's immoral ideas on governing. C. A good ruler should do whatever it takes to secure and unite his state. D. Machiavelli based his work on his study of classical history and on what he saw around him.

Machiavell's famous work "The Prince" was a book that was written on the subject of power and governance, how to secure it, and ultimately how to maintain it. Out of these answers Machiavelli wrote on how a C) good ruler should do whatever it takes to secure and unite his state, D) Machiavelli based his work on his study of classical history and on what he saw around him.
